Don't sneer at par. Par would have won you the Masters and made you rich
Are you one of those golfers who sneers at par? You don’t excited about anything but birdies and eagles?
Check this: The LPGA did a study in which it concluded that a player who finished at par at all official events would have won $600,000 and finished 24th on the money list.
Over on the boys side, par would have won The Masters and U.S. Open, and you would have won more than $4 million, putting you fifth on the money list.
So don’t be so arrogant next time you “settle” for par.
